Recording to the memory card takes too long, or continuous shooting is slower. ●● Use the camera to perform low-level formatting of the memory card (=154). Shooting settings or FUNC. menu settings are not available. ●● Available setting items vary by shooting mode. Refer to "Functions Available in Each Shooting Mode", "FUNC. Menu", and "Shooting Tab" (=181 - =186). The Babies or Children icon does not display. ●● The Babies and Children icons will not display if the birthday is not set in face information (=44). If the icons still do not display even when you set the birthday, re-register face information (=44), or make sure that the date/time are set correctly (=152). Touch AF or Touch Shutter does not work. ●● Touch AF or Touch Shutter will not work if you touch the edges of the screen. Touch closer to the center of the screen. Shooting Movies The elapsed time shown is incorrect, or recording is interrupted. ●● Use the camera to format the memory card, or switch to a card that supports high-speed recording. Note that even if the elapsed time display is incorrect, the length of movies on the memory card corresponds to the actual recording time (=154, =196). [ ] is displayed and shooting stops automatically. ●● The camera's internal memory buffer filled up as the camera could not record to the memory card quickly enough. Try one of the following measures. -- Use the camera to perform low-level formatting of the memory card (=154). -- Lower the image quality (=50). -- Switch to a memory card that supports high-speed recording (=196). Zooming is not possible. ●● Zooming is not possible in [ ] mode (=66). ●● Zooming is not possible when shooting movies in [ ] mode (=60). Subjects look distorted. ●● Subjects that pass in front of the camera quickly may look distorted. This is not a malfunction. Playback Playback is not possible. ●● Image or movie playback may not be possible if a computer is used to rename files or alter the folder structure. Refer to "Software Instruction Manual" (= 163) for details on folder structure and file names. Playback stops, or audio skips. ●● Switch to a memory card that you have performed low-level formatting on with the camera (=154). ●● There may be brief interruptions when playing movies copied to memory cards that have slow read speeds. ●● When movies are played on a computer, frames may be dropped and audio may skip if computer performance is inadequate. Sound is not played during movies. ●● Adjust the volume (=151) if you have activated [Mute] (=151) or the sound in the movie is faint. ●● No sound is played for movies shot in [ ] (=60) or [ ] (=69) mode because audio is not recorded in these modes. Memory Card The memory card is not recognized. ●● Restart the camera, with the memory card in it (=26).
